What to do if your on your period while swimming?

What to do if your on your period while swimming? Swimming during your period isn’t a problem. However, you will want to use a tampon when swimming so you don’t bleed on your swimsuit. Pads won’t work and will just fill with water. The tampon won’t fall out if it is inserted correctly, so go ahead and make a splash!

How do I stop my period from bleeding while swimming? If your flow is light, you can wear absorbent swimwear or a dark-colored suit to prevent stains. Waterproof absorbent swimwear looks like regular bikini bottoms but has a hidden, leak-proof lining that helps absorb menstrual blood.

Does your period stop if you swim? “Blood typically flows out from the uterus into the vagina through the cervix because of gravity, and the water pressure can decrease the flow while swimming,” says Ho. So it can slow your flow but it doesn’t totally stop your flow from happening.

Is it okay to wear a pad while swimming? Swimming on your period with a pad is not advised. Pads are made out of absorbent material that soaks up liquids within seconds. Submerged in water like a pool, a pad will completely fill with water, leaving no room for it to absorb your menstrual fluid. Plus, it may swell up into a big soppy mess.

Can you swim with an earache?

Can my child go swimming with an ear infection? That depends on the ear infection. If the ear drum did not rupture then they can swim if it isn’t causing pain. Going underwater and changing pressure can be painful with an ear infection, but playing in the water (and not going under) shouldn’t be a problem.

Can you swim in turquoise lake colorado?

Swimming: Swimming is permitted in Turquoise Lake, however the bone-chilling alpine conditions rarely make the water desirable for visitors. With that said, a bit of bravery or a wetsuit can create the right moment for a refreshing dip in the reservoir.

Why does my goldfish like to swim upside down?

A upside-down swimming is a common problem in goldfish and the cause is a disorder of the swim bladder. This specialised organ enables a fish to modify its buoyancy so it can dive or surface according to its needs. Fat-bodied goldfish are at risk because their swim bladder can become compressed.

Do carp swim upstream to spawn?

Like the salmon and trout that are stocked in the Great Lakes, bighead and silver carp are lake fish that swim up tributaries to spawn. The impulse to spawn is usually in response to a flood pulse, the seasonal flooding of relatively flat, low-lying areas adjacent to major rivers.

How does webbed feet help animals swim?

Webbed Feet: Most mammals and birds that spend a lot of time swimming in or propelling themselves along the surface of water have webbed feet. The webbing is a piece of flat skin between the surface of the toes. It pushes against the water column making movement of the animal easier.

How to be a swimming teacher uk?

The first qualification you will need is the Swim England Level 1 Certificate. This focuses on how to teach or coach and what to teach or coach. Once you have received your certificate you will be qualified to support a more senior qualified or licensed teacher/coach at any level in a pre-prepared session.
